Omaha and Utah beaches
This tour will take you to sectors where the American V Corps and VII Corps landings occurred at Omaha and Utah beaches. You will follow the steps of the famous 1st, 29th, and 4th American Infantry Divisions and the other units that linked up with them. You will also be taken to the misplaced drop zones of the 82nd and 101st Airborne Units that landed in the early morning hours of the D-Day Invasion on June 6, 1944.
Normandy WW2 British Jeep Tour
A unique way to see and feel the Normandy coast
Gold Beach Company offers a unique jeep tour in an authentic World War II Willy’s Jeep! The tour stops at the Arromanches Mullberry Harbor, where British engineers built a deep-water port to unload the logistics that brought Victory to Normandy. The Longues sur Mer German battery is the best-preserved site of the Atlantic wall. Discover how British and French naval vessels silenced the guns on D-Day. Finally come to visit a poignant cemetery at Ryes Bazenville which helps one reflects the enormous sacrifice.

DDay American Beaches and US Airborne Full Day Tour from Bayeux
The best way to get an overview of the American involvement on D-Day is in a small group of a maximum of 8 people, with plenty of details given by our experienced guides. You will have the chance to discover every aspect of the sacrifice made by American soldiers on June 6, 1944.
We will cover the American seaborne operation by visiting the two beaches where US soldiers landed, Omaha Beach and Utah Beach, as well as the German strongpoint of Pointe du Hoc, assaulted by the US Army Rangers. We will also visit the sites of the US Airborne Operation, including its most iconic site, Sainte-Mère-Eglise, where a terrible battle happened on the night of June 5, 1944. Finally, we will have the chance to pay our respects to the thousands of men who gave their lives to liberate Europe by visiting the Normandy American Cemetery.

Mt St. Michel Private Tour with Abbey tickets and tour guide
Discover the magic of Mont Saint-Michel with a private guide who tailors the visit to your pace and interests. Your tour begins at the main parking area by the shuttle stop, from where you ride together towards the island. Crossing the bridge, admire the breathtaking views before entering the medieval village. Stroll along the fortified walls, pass through the iconic Porte du Roy, explore the Grand’Rue and its charming side streets, and visit the parish church of Saint-Pierre.
The highlight of the experience is the visit to the Abbey, located at the summit of the mount. Step inside to explore its stunning Gothic church, the cloister, refectory, scriptorium, guest halls, and atmospheric crypts spread across three levels. Your guide balances time between the village and abbey—about half each—while adapting to your walking pace, needs, and schedule.
